#ae4e01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ae4e01 is composed of 68.2% red, 30.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 99.4%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 26.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#ae4e01 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9c02 with #5d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#ae4e01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ae4e01 has RGB values of R:174, G:78,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.99,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11423233.

Shades and Tints of #ae4e01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120800 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ae4e01
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5752 is the less saturated color, while #ae4e01 is the most saturated one.
